Fuzzy's Sick... We went for a long walk and when we got back she crashed on the couch. Then she got up and ate all of her food. Then she started lying down unresponsively and throwing up until she'd thrown up her whole dinner. Now she is very tired and not too responsive although she'll lift her head and look around from time to time. I'm definately planning to take her to the vet tomorrow, but do you think I should take her to the emergency room tonight? |
If I were you I'd at least call the emergency vet. They can tell you whether or not they think you should bring her in. Excessive throwing up is never good though, you should probably take her in just to be safe. :( Hope she's okay! Keep us updated! Quote:
|
If this is unusual behavior for her, I would call the ER vet tonight. They can do a phone consultation and tell you whether you should bring her in. How old is she? Does she have any known health issues? |
Poor baby! I would def. call, like the others said. It may be best to take her in tonight, and could actually end up costing you less than if you waited, because if she throws up all night she could get really dehydrated. Poor girl, please keep us posted. |
Thanks everyone - she drank water after she threw up and hasn't thrown up in an hour or so, so I'm not too worried about her being dehydrated... We'll call the ER and see what they say... |
are her gums nice and pink? do her eyes look "there" or does she appear off somewhere. When you think about it.. if we go for a very long walk.. and then we were to come home and eat.. we would probably throw it up too... will she eat a treat if you give her one??? i'd keep an eye on her... try offering her small amounts of kibble.. or something bland like cheerios and see if she can keep small amounts down... if she is really worrying you call the ER vet but something tells me she just over did it :) |
